Recipe: Fast Fajitas
For 4 Persons
Category: Beef, Mexican, Favorites
1 lb Flank steak
3 tb Orange juice
3 tb Red wine vinegar
1 ts Seasoned salt
1 ts Dried oregano -- leaves, not
Ground
1 ts Cumin seed
1/4 ts Chili sauce
2 Cloves garlic -- minced
3/4 lb Onion -- thickly sliced
1 Red bell pepper -- or green
6 Tortillas
3 c Iceberg lettuce -- shredded
Salsa
1. Slice steak across grain 1/8 inch thick. Combine with juice, vinegar,
seas. salt, oregano, cumin, chili sauce, and garlic, coating evenly.
Marinate 10 min or up to 1 hour.
2. Meanwhile, place onion and bell pepper on a broiler pan; broil 4-6
inches from heat about 10 min, turning as needed to brown all sides evenly.
Turn broiler off; close oven door. Let vegetables set 5 min; remove skin
from pepper and slice.
3. In a 10-12 inch frying pan, heat 2 teaspoons of oil over high heat. Add
half of beef; stir fry until barely pink, 3 to 5 min. Repeat with rest of
beef; add more oil if needed. Place beef, onion, and pepper on a platter;
serve with warm tortillas, lettuce, and salsa.
